The Difference Between Ivy and Houzz Pro
September 26, 2024 - Yes—back in 2019, Houzz acquired Ivy with the goal of helping design firms of all sizes streamline their workflow and grow their business. By enhancing Ivy’s fan-favorite features and adding new ones to complement them, Houzz Pro now helps designers manage their business, present their designs, and offer an exceptional client experience along the way. Do You Need to Fear The Houzz Acquisition of Ivy?
August 20, 2025 - In particular, many designers feel like Houzz doesn’t add value to the industry and is instead poaching its traffic and monetizing it by demanding advertising dollars from home pros. They also accuse it of making money off the sweat of design pros. On the other side of the merger is Ivy – a project management software that allows collaboration between designer and client.

Houzz Pro has arrived just in time for designers with virtual projects
May 7, 2020 - (While Ivy users can still access the platform as a stand-alone product, the company says that designers who migrate to Houzz Pro will get access to the new platform’s marketing features and additional business management tools.) “We wanted to give our design community one place where they can manage and grow their business, instead of having to sign into multiple platforms,” explains Hausman.
